Title
Applying comb filter to noise reduction of hearing aid

Abstract
We developed a noise reduction method for a digital hearing aid. In order to utilize the comb filter method for noise reduction, a detection method of fundamental frequency of human voice is developed using the time continuous property of spectrum envelopes, and the suppression methods of strange sounds accompanying the filtering are also developed. Performance of the noise reduction was verified by test hearing. We conclude that the proposed method is effective for noise reduction of the hearing aid
